Susan. O, I didn’t know you was here, Mistress Julia.
Julia. Well, Susan, and so you live at Road Farm. Are you happy there?
Susan. I should be if ’twern’t for mistress.
Julia. No mistress could speak harshly to you, Susan—you are so young and pretty.
Susan. Ah, but mistress takes no account of aught but the work you does, and the tongue of her be wonderful lashing.
Julia. Then how comes it that you have got away to the forest so early on a week day?
Susan. ’Tis that mistress be powerful took up with sommat else this afternoon, and so I was able to run out for a while and her didn’t notice me.
Tansie. Why Su, what’s going on up at the farm so particular to-day?
Susan. ’Tis courting.
All. Courting?
